Description: The Bristol Beaufighter was designed as a two-seat long-range fighter. To speed up production many parts of the older Bristol Beaufort were used. The tail, landing gear and wings of the Beaufort were transplanted to the Beaufighter and most units were equipped with airborne radar located in the nose for night-fighting. The Mk. IF was the initial production and fitted with four 20 mm cannons in the nose along with six 7.7 mm machine guns in the wings. There were a total of 553 of the IF version produced. “B” for Bambi entered operations with 29 Squadron based at West Malling, Kent on July 27 1942. The regular crew was Squadron Leader Richards and Flight Sergeant Mills. In November 1942 the aircraft undercarriage was damaged when it hit a tree on final approach. The plane was repaired, painted the new grey/green night fighter camouflage scheme and transferred to No. 51 OUT (Operational Training Unit). On September 17 1944 Bambi was destroyed when it dived out of cloud into the ground near Barton-in-the- Clay, Bedfordshire.
